Re: $600m Jets’ Deal Raises US Imports Of Nigeria’s Crude by Adminisher: 7:41pm On Apr 25, 2017
Agbanagba1:
At $50 million the A29 super Tucano jet is extremely overpriced. It is listed as about $10million in reuter's website.
Where people get their prices from is a mystery.
A combat aircraft is a flying integration of systems. An aircraft company quotes the price of airframe, engine and very basic avionics in the 2000 and people are running with it. SMH.
Anyone who expects SuperTucano to be cheaper than the MI 35 chopper is not being realistic
